Chapter 420: Chapter 9: Cyan Ox Mountain (3/3)

Gurgle, gurgle...

It wasn’t until Lu Huaijin left with Xi that a few bubbles suddenly emerged from the reservoir not far away.

Soon after, a gigantic Human-faced Fish slowly surfaced from the water, revealing a gentle female face on its back.

"A prophecy?"

The Red Fish gazed at the departing figures of Lu Huaijin and Xi, unconsciously showing some worry on its face.

This wasn’t the first time Red Fish protected Xi in secret.

Although Li Boyang had never asked Red Fish to protect his family.

Yet out of affection for him, Red Fish kept a close watch on everyone related to him.

Especially after Xi awakened the "Destiny Communication".

Red Fish had quietly driven away many Gods who coveted her ability and talent.

So, Red Fish understood the power and terror of "Destiny Communication" better than anyone.

Since the prophecy mentioned the sky turning completely dark, this scene would inevitably occur in the future.

Xi, whose mind was still immature, only focused on the vision of Ying Long being injured.

But the news of the sky turning completely dark held the most information within this prophecy.

What kind of situation would cause the sky to turn completely dark?

The last time a similar event happened in the Hundred Lands Mountain Range was due to the "Solar Eclipse" phenomenon caused by the emergence of the Celestial Erosion Monarch.

"Could it be related to the Celestial Erosion Monarch?"

Their gaze unconsciously drifted to the depths of Yunmeng Marsh.

Red Fish believed they weren’t the only one thinking this; Lu Huaijin surely realized it too.

"I’d better discuss it with Li Jingshu first!"

Mumbling softly, Red Fish silently submerged back into the water, then swam out of the reservoir along the current.

Although this reservoir wasn’t as interconnected as Yunmeng Marsh, able to reach any corner of the Hundred Lands Mountain Range.

But as the return stream and breeding ground for Human-faced Fish, this water vein also connected to many crucial places.

Like the pool beneath Feilai Peak, for example.

However, Red Fish wasn’t heading to Feilai Peak this time.

She was going to the burial site of Guhuo Bird Hidden Flight, the "Cyan Ox Mountain" overturned by the Unihorned Rhinoceros.

This mountain, located near Mountain Village, was made famous by the Unihorned Rhinoceros’s upheaval.

At the foot of this mountain, a shrine was even dedicated to the Unihorned Rhinoceros.

Usually, the villagers of Mountain Village and passing mountain people would offer their respects, hoping to receive the protection of this deity capable of overturning mountains.

Swish, swish...

Red Fish swam freely through the water, and her body gradually shrunk in the process.

By the time Red Fish passed Mountain Village and arrived near Unihorn Peak, she had already shrunk to the size of a normal Human-faced Fish.

"Phew!"

"It’s been so long since I last stepped ashore, I’m not quite used to it anymore."

Step by step, she walked out of the water, transforming into the image of a Divine Maiden emerging from a bath.

Yin Yang Qi quickly gathered around her, soon forming a complete set of splendid attire.

On this attire, the black and white Yin Yang Fish could be seen swimming around, with the river water not leaving a trace.

Despite her short time as a God,

in the favored teachings of Li Boyang, her achievements with the Yin Yang Talisman even surpassed those of the Celestial Erosion Monarch.

Visiting Feilai Peak from time to time for special lessons from Li Boyang was a part of Red Fish’s routine.

Though Red Fish herself cared little for such knowledge.

She simply enjoyed the time spent with Li Boyang.

But undeniably, if Red Fish wished, she could easily abandon her physical form and transform into a true Celestial God.

However, Red Fish clearly wouldn’t make such a foolish choice.

Refining Essence and Qi, Qi Refining and Divinity Transformation, and then Refining Spirit and Returning to Void.

Currently, Red Fish advances steadily on the Three Paths of Essence, Qi, and Spirit, with cultivation rivaling the heart firmly set on the Dao like Xuansi Gu.

In time, once any path is perfected, Red Fish would have the opportunity to reach the supreme state of Refining Spirit and Returning to Void, why would she go down the one-way path of a Celestial God?

...........................

After Red Fish ascended the mountain, the first thing she saw was the conspicuous tombstone.

Beside the tombstone, Li Jingshu, who had been waiting for half a month, was scratching her head, accompanied by Human-faced Spider Xiaogui and the Bronze Treasure Book.

"Eh? Why are you here?"

Immediately noticing Red Fish’s arrival, Xiaogui landed in surprise atop Li Jingshu’s head.

Xiaogui didn’t know much about Red Fish, the only Reservoir God.

Not just because she was naturally aloof and elusive, rarely revealing her true form to anyone other than Li Boyang,

but also because Red Fish never appeared without significance, and whenever she showed up, it typically meant something big was at hand.

"Red Fish?"

"Did something happen in the village?"

Just a fraction slower than Xiaogui, Li Jingshu also noticed Red Fish’s presence.

Compared to Xiaogui, Li Jingshu was much more familiar with Red Fish.

After all, as a top student attending Li Boyang’s private lessons, Li Jingshu was often compared to her.

Though Li Jingshu was not convinced by this, believing she could easily surpass Red Fish with her strength.

But unfortunately, Li Boyang never judged learning based on combat ability.

"It’s Li Xi; she saw another dangerous future."

In the past five years, Xi had foreseen extremely dangerous futures multiple times.

Most of these dangers were dealt with personally by Li Jingshu.

Thus, she preemptively thwarted many potential disasters that could threaten the entire Hundred Lands Mountain Range.

"But what about you, you’re waiting here for half a month and still haven’t found that Flower Mantis?"

Since the death of Night Traveling Maiden Hidden Flight, the Flower Mantis had become its tomb guardian.

It usually watched over the grave, only occasionally descending the mountain for food.

The current situation, being absent for half a month, seemed unprecedented.

"I’m troubled over this too!"

"That fellow is undeniably a dangerous element."

"When I received news that he was fighting someone for unknown reasons, I immediately came here to wait."

"Yet that guy hasn’t returned even today; who knows if he’s dead somewhere?"

Watching Li Jingshu slip into distress, Red Fish slightly furrowed her brow, a faint sense of foreboding rising within her.

"Although the Flower Mantis isn’t a God, its combat prowess should not be underestimated."

"Who else in the Hundred Lands Mountain Range can match him? Is it a God?"

Upon hearing this, Li Jingshu decisively shook her head.

"I asked around, it’s not a God, at least not one of our Hundred Lands Mountain Range."

The unsettling feeling in Red Fish’s heart grew stronger, instinctively leading to a connection.

"Could the Flower Mantis’s disappearance be related to Li Xi’s prophecy?"
